Michigan’s Jordan Jersey Release Tweet-Cap

When Michigan signed on with Nike and the Jordan brand, expectations on the new jersey and apparel designs went through the roof. And for good reason. Nike has been the pinnacle of football jerseys and apparel while Jordan is one of the biggest boutique (for lack of a better word) brands in the world. That Jumpman logo is something sneaker heads, recruits and fans of sporting apparel want, and now Michigan is the only football program to have it.

On Sunday night, the streets of Ann Arbor were shut down for the apparel launch. That event included speeches from the likes of Jim Harbaugh, Lamarr Woodley, Jimmy King and Rashan Gary. So, it was obvious that the jersey release on Tuesday was going to be memorable as well.

While the apparel launch at The MDen was perfect for a college, the jersey launch in Detroit at the Ford Piquette Plant was a scene out of futuristic fashion runway show:
